General Discussion / Re: Does anyone have a HD radio ?
« on: August 05, 2009, 12:02:30 PM »
HD Radio is the marketing name for one type (the most popular type) of digital radio invented by a company called ibiquity.
It is a digital signal rides on top of (technically on the sides of) the analog radio signal and works on both AM and FM.

For either FM or AM HD radio, if you cannot receive the analog signal, you will not be able to get the digital signal.  AM digital radio tends to not work very well at night unless you get a 100% solid signal.

So, if you cannot get WCBS 880 analog, you will not WCBS digital.

If you are looking for Yankee games, try WVMT am-620 in Burlington or WIRY am-1340 in Plattsburgh.
I am not necessarily a 'Yankee fan (more of a Braves fan, really) but John Sterling may just be the best radio play-by-play person...ever.

Vermont Public Radio runs digital FM radio, and they have multiple digital channels that carry their regular 107.9 program, plus VPR classical and BCC world service.  All you need is the HD radio.
